Lee's correlations
Obvious that - 1. Lee did not find his lower shale
and lower & middle ss easy to pick out in
Denver basin area. 2. At Turkey Creek he put
upper sandy part Morrison as his lower &
middle ss of Dakota.
At type Morrison he was confused and had
to misinterpret Eldridge to make his
idea of section fit that of Eldridge. Actually,
his lower ss, lower sh, & middleless correlate with
the upper sandy part of the type Morrison.
Assuming his other correlations correct
then -

Also - the sandy upper part type Morrison =
Cloverly and Lakota - Fuson.
Fall River is prob ss that is only 10' ±
of type Morrison area + sits on sh. overlying
basal Det cal. This ss thickens to
north + is t 60 at Eldorado Spgs.
